KOKKEPLASSEN EIENDOM AS is registered as a limited company in Grimstad, Agder with organisation number 989986902. The business is classified under rental and operating of own or leased real estate (NACE 68.200). The company was incorporated in 2006. Registered share capital is NOK 600,000, divided into 100 shares. The company's stated purpose is: “Investere i fast eiendom eller selskaper som eier fast eiendom, og alt som dermed står i forbindelse.”. The most recent filed accounts, for the 2024 financial year, show NOK 26.4m in revenue and NOK 9.9m in operating profit.
